Technology undoubtedly has many advantages that businesses can benefit from. Over the years, the use of sound technology strategies has proved to result in improved profits and overall growth. There are some telecommunications solutions that modern businesses ought to have.

Of late, cloud computing has been getting a lot of emphasis from stakeholders in technology and business. There are a plethora of benefits that it has for medium and large businesses. Cloud solutions are generally known to lower infrastructural costs in business that uptake them.

For instance, you are likely to spend a significant amount of money buying storage systems if your enterprise has a heavy reliance on customer data to conduct business. Cloud computing offers a perfect solution owing to the fact that it allows one to store unlimited data and access it remotely at a relatively small fee. Furthermore, service providers always take the effort to encrypt the data they store, making it safe from unauthorized access.

This concept can benefit your business immensely if it is the 24 hour type. You may have your production apps hosted on remote servers and in turn allow your people to access them without having to physically be in your premises. In essence, it removes the physical boundaries that hinder communication. Whether your employees are scattered across the US or in Europe, they should easily access the apps they need to do their work effectively.

Communication is undoubtedly essential in modern day commerce. Companies have to pitch their products to customers regularly. Furthermore, company boards ought to meet occasionally to chart the way forward. Such aspects make teleconferencing systems and IP phones absolutely necessary. They are better and more reliable than the landline telephones that were predominant in the past.

IP phones work through the use of computer networks. By interfacing them in your network, your employees can contact customers without having to spend a fortune on airtime. Your primary focus will be on meeting the bandwidth needs of the network.

Teleconferencing systems, also a feature of IP phones, also allow multiple people to communicate simultaneously via a single channel. This means your people will no longer have to plan for expensive meetings in designated places. All this can be done via the phone today. What this means is that your business will make savings that can be channeled to other important areas.

Fiber networks are also important. They provide better speeds than Ethernet networks. Speed is an important factor in any growing enterprise.

With an overhaul, you will notice great improvements in internet speed. You can send emails faster and make your systems more scalable. Call quality also improves with the integration of fiber connectivity. It eliminates incidences of dropped calls and breakages in IP phone networks.
